A plate of meat


Ingredients:

3 cups flour
2 tbsp milk powder
1 teaspoon salt
1 tablespoon yeast
1 tablespoon sugar
1 teaspoon baking powder
1/4 cup corn oil
1 cup warm water

Padding:

500g finely chopped meat
2 large onion grated
2 large tomato, grated
2 garlic cloves, crushed
2 century green pepper, chopped fine
1/4 cup pomegranate molasses
1/4 cup tahini
1/4 cup Rob / yogurt
1 teaspoon cinnamon
1 teaspoon salt
1/4 teaspoon black pepper
1 teaspoon seasoning
1/2 cup pine nuts
